Reed Elliotte, an 11-year-old history lover and presidential expert, appeared on The Ellen DeGeneres Show on December 28 to chat with guest host Jojo Siwa about his love for history. The young guest, who wore a red, white and blue suit, shared that he’s an “old soul” and feels as if he’s 81 years old. To celebrate his “81st birthday,” Elliotte had a party inspired by Loretta Lynn, who he admits is his “celebrity crush.” The party featured a cake with Lynn’s picture on it as well as performances of her songs by Elliotte himself. 

“She was the theme of my birthday party,” Eliotte told Siwa. “I sang some of her songs like ‘Coal Miner’s Daughter,’ ‘You Ain’t Woman Enough’ and ‘Whispering Sea,’ which was the first song she’d written.” 

The young history fan also went on to talk about his admiration for 12-year-old Macey Hensley, another presidential expert. Hensley has appeared on the show multiple times since 2015. Elliotte shared that, while he has chatted with Hensley on the phone, he has yet to meet her. Guest host Siwa then surprised Elliotte as Hensley walked onstage. The two shared their admiration for one another and Hensley presented Elliotte with a gift set containing books and presidential trinkets. 

“I think it’s awesome that you’re trying to learn about the presidents and coming out here and inspiring other younger kids to go out and learn about that stuff because that stuff is awesome,” Hensley told Elliotte. 

At the end of the interview, Elliotte shared his story of beating cancer twice. Siwa then presented Elliotte with a check for $10,000 to support him and his family after his cancer battle.
